Title: Senior Business Development Representative Location: Boston, MA, USA Department: Sales Team Employees can work remotely Full-time Department: Sales Team Compensation: USD 55,000 - USD 60,000 - yearly Job Description: Company Description At Thought Industries, we are disrupting the Customer Learning & Intelligence space with a platform designed to drive measurable outcomes for the world’s most innovative companies. Our team is fueled by a start-up mindset: focused, agile, accountable—and relentlessly committed to solving real business problems for our customers. We’re scaling rapidly and looking for an entrepreneurial, driven Senior Business Development Representative to join our high-performance sales team. The Opportunity As a Senior Business Development Representative (BDR), you’ll play a pivotal role in building our presence within the Enterprise market. You’ll be responsible for qualifying inbound leads and creating pipeline via your outbound efforts to ICP (Ideal Client Profile) targets. You will partner with Though Industries’ Account Executives to grow our client base. This role is designed for someone who thrives in fast-paced, high-growth environments and is passionate about building new business relationships. What You’ll Be Doing - Pipeline Generation: Participate in new customer prospecting, uncovering leads, and driving pipeline growth through outbound prospecting. - Lead Management: Qualify inbound sales leads and demo requests generated from Marketing efforts. - Appointment Setting: Once qualified, set appointments for the Account Executive team to conduct further discovery for potential fit. - Event Support: Drive attendance for marketing-sponsored events, as requested. - Social Selling: Leverage LinkedIn to conduct social selling in your territory to build relationships with potential customers. - Sales Execution: Maintain standard activity levels related to outbound activities, meetings held and pipeline conversion to opportunities. - Sales Operations: Manage and report on your sales activity in Thought Industries’ CRM system. Qualifications What We’re Looking For Proven success in outbound pipeline generation Experience selling SaaS or technology solutions into Enterprise accounts Professional presence with the ability to engage confidently with VP and C-suite stakeholders Highly motivated, resourceful, and comfortable with a passion for building, iterating, and winning Adhere to the highest ethical standards and conduct, honors commitments, and treats people with kindness, compassion, trust and respect What You Bring to the Table - Bachelor's Degree. - Minimum of 2 years previous B2B SaaS Sales Experience. - Track record of self-sourcing opportunities. - Strong business acumen. - Comfortable speaking to potential and current customers over the phone and video including demoing solutions through remote software. - Ability to identify and qualify sales leads based on qualification criteria. - Excellent verbal and written communication skills. - Passionate, motivated and hungry to succeed. - Experience calling executives in marketing and online digital roles - Prior knowledge of the Learning Technology space is a plus - SalesForce, LinkedIn and Google Workspace Experience required. - Experience with Gong, Outreach, Apollo, ZoomInfo, or similar tools is a plus Why Join Us? - High-growth, fast-paced environment with room for ownership and impact - Direct exposure to executive leadership, including the CRO - Opportunity to shape GTM strategy and influence company trajectory - Competitive compensation, equity, and uncapped commission structure - Culture that values grit, accountability, and celebrating success If you thrive in building from the ground up, embrace ambiguity, and know how to close complex deals—this is your seat at the table. Apply now and help us redefine growth in the Enterprise space. Additional Information All your information will be kept confidential according to EEO guidelines. The annual base salary range for this role is $55,000 - $60,000 with commission earnings up to $30,000.
